Helping the Valley Center Community For Over 50 Years

Since 1967, Jack & Caroline Bose have owned & operated A-1 Irrigation, Inc. Always looking for ways to improve their customer needs and give back to the community. What started as a fertilizer, insecticides, and irrigation system installations has evolved into what it is today. We pride our store with providing excellent customer service and we will always try our best to get the products you need for your next project.
